  • Identifying Invasive Plants in Your Yard

    Davidson Public Library 119 South Main Street, Davidson, NC

    Join Lauren Collver, DLC's very own assistant director as part of Charlotte Mecklenburg Library's education program and learn the basics of habitat restoration and how to identify invasive plants in your yard.  This program will help you identify the common culprits among invasive plants as well as how to weigh the pros and cons of removal
